Back to the office for top South African IT company's employees

iOCO CEO Rhys Summerton said all staff at the company have returned to the office, which has led to productivity benefits.

Between 2020 and 2024, EOH, which rebranded as iOCO in December 2024, was a strong advocate of remote work.
